FACILITIES MAINTENANCE II ( WASTE WATER )

Key Responsibilities
- Perform general and skilled landscaping.
- Perform general and skilled janitorial functions.
- Perform general and skilled construction trade functions.
- Cookball, remodel, refurbish areas as needed.
- Remove and properly dispose of all recyclable materials.
- Change light bulbs, interior and exterior, as needed.
- Maintain exterior property, including snow removal from walkways and sprinkling ice melt down to keep people from falling.
- Make repairs and alterations to building interior and exterior.
- Perform general day-to-day maintenance tasks, inspections, repair and alterations to buildings and grounds and shop equipment.
- Ensures that facilities are available for use and consistently maintained in a safe and clean condition.
- Assembles, repairs, maintains, and moves furniture, such as desks, cabinets, tables, chairs, shelves, and related fittings and fixtures.
- This is a multi-craft role requiring the ability to learn and stay current with the technical needs of our equipment/plant.
- Operates and maintains a variety of hand and power tools and equipment related to activities.
- Troubleshoots and repairs various pieces of equipment using several diagnostic skills/tools (ladder logic, volt meters, etc.).
- Interprets specifications, blueprints, schematics, and work orders in performing duties.
- Acts in a manner that is consistent with Butterball’s core values.
- Must be able to work in both teams and on an individual basis in performing this role.
- Must be self-directed and focused on utilizing time efficiently.
- Utilizes and adheres to various company policies to include safety and food safety regulations.
- Accurately tracks work assignments (time), accounts for parts and completes required paperwork.
- Responsible for performing all duties as assigned by management.
Minimum Qualifications
- 2 years of previous experience working in at least one maintenance discipline.
- High School Diploma or GED preferred.
- Certificate/Diploma in Industrial Maintenance or similar area strongly preferred.
Essential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ities
- Follow diagrams, operation manuals, manufacturing instructions and troubleshooting malfunctions.
- Communicate with all levels in organization.
- Ability to work independently to make decisions with minimal supervision.
- Ability to read and understand written instructions.
- Good Communication.
- Basic Mathematical Skills.
- Ability to lift to 50 pounds.
Preferred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ities
- Weld equipment and parts using mig, tig, and stick methods.
- Perform mill/lathe work as needed.
- Perform plumbing work as needed.
- Bilingual English/Spanish preferred.
Physical Demands
- While performing the duties of this job, an IMT is frequently required to stand, walk, have hands/finger dexterity, reach with hands/arms, stoop, crouch, kneel, crawl, climb, speak and hear.
- The IMT is occasionally required to l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
Working Conditions & Travel Requirements
- Work in Seasonal Outdoor conditions.
- Work in dusty environment.
- Work with chemical or Fumes.
- Work around pungent odors.
- Work assignments may range across the entirety of the plant complex, including non-refrigerated and refrigerated areas, with temperatures that range from -20 degrees Fahrenheit to 90+ degrees Fahrenheit.
- Must wear the required PPE to include steel toe shoes, safety glasses, hardhat, safety vest, gloves, and hearing protection.
- The noise level of the office environment is usually moderate; the noise level in the manufacturing environment may exceed 85 DBA and require hearing protection.
- May work with raw and/or cooked meat as well as animal byproducts from the turkey production process.
